  I don't know that this will help you at all... and I'm a noob with small hardware... but I have ben able to get an ESS1689 running under DSL.  Mine is in a 10 year old Compaq laptop.  It might be worth a try for you as well.
  The console command that worked for me is:
 | Code Sample  |   modprobe sb io=0x220 irq=5 dma=1 dma16=5 mpu_io=0x330
  |  
 
  I learned about it from this thread: Sound on es1869
  The key points are that you know what the BIOS settings for your card are.  I was lucky, I had reset the BIOS to factory settings before trying the above and my values all lined up exactly as the thread told.
